### 引言

以太坊作为当前最受欢迎的区块链平台之一,正在快速发展并在全球范围内吸引着大量投资者和开发者的关注。在这个数字资产日益增多的时代,了解以太坊钱包公钥的功能及其重要性显得尤为重要。本文将深入探讨以太坊钱包公钥,包括其结构、作用,以及如何安全地管理和使用它,确保用户的隐私和资产安全。

### 什么是以太坊钱包公钥?

以太坊钱包公钥是用户在以太坊网络中与其他用户进行交易时使用的账户地址的组成部分。每个以太坊钱包都有一对密钥,包括公钥和私钥,其中公钥是可以公开分享的,而私钥则必须严格保密不被泄露。公钥由私钥生成,无法从公钥反推私钥,这一单向性为用户提供了安全保障。

公钥的主要功能是用于接收以太坊(ETH)或其他代币。当用户想要向另一个以太坊钱包发送资产时,他们需要提供对方的钱包公钥,通过这个公钥进行交易的验证和确认。

### 以太坊钱包公钥的组成

以太坊钱包公钥通常由一串字符组成,前缀为“0x”,后接40个十六进制字符。总的来说,公钥的格式可以表示为:

0x 40个十六进制字符

例如,一个典型的以太坊公钥可能是这样的:

0x32be3435e9f68b818c0816e28d9e3c5a95a8f1b

公钥通过椭圆曲线数字签名算法(ECDSA)生成,并且具有不可伪造和不可篡改的性质,为网络交易提供了可靠性和安全性。

### 以太坊钱包公钥的安全性

尽管公钥是可以公开分享的,但用户在使用和管理以太坊钱包时依然需要保持警惕。如下所述,部分安全措施可以帮助用户更好地保护自己的资产:

1. **保持私钥的安全性**:私钥是访问钱包资产的唯一凭证。若私钥被他人获取,则资产将面临被盗的风险。因此,用户在使用钱包时,必须选择可靠的钱包提供商并妥善保管自己的私钥。 2. **使用硬件钱包**:硬件钱包是一种安全性更高的钱包形式,它将私钥存储在一个离线设备中,降低了在线攻击的风险。用户可以通过连接到计算机来进行交易,但是私钥不会暴露在互联网上。 3. **定期备份钱包信息**:用户应定期备份他们的钱包数据,并将备份保存在安全的位置。这样可以在设备丢失或损坏时,轻松恢复钱包的访问权限。 4. **启用两步验证**:许多钱包提供两步验证功能,用户在每次登录或进行交易时,都需要提供额外的身份验证信息,以增强安全性。 ### 如何生成以太坊钱包公钥?

生成以太坊钱包公钥的过程可以通过不同的钱包工具和程序库实现。以下是通过一些常见工具生成公钥的基本步骤:

1. **选择钱包工具**:可以使用像MetaMask、MyEtherWallet或硬件钱包(如Ledger、Trezor)等工具进行钱包创建和管理。 2. **创建账户**:在选定的工具上创建一个新账户,系统将自动为您生成一对公钥和私钥。 3. **备份私钥**:在生成过程中,请务必安全保存私钥,并启用必要的安全措施(如两步验证)。 4. **获取公钥**:钱包生成后,您将在界面上或通过命令行工具看到您的公钥,您可以将其复制以用于后续交易。 ### 常见问题解答 #### 以太坊钱包公钥与地址有什么区别?

以太坊钱包公钥与地址有什么区别?

以太坊钱包公钥与地址之间存在一定的区别。公钥是生成以太坊地址的基础,而以太坊地址则是用户在网络上接收交易时所使用的具体地址。整个过程如下:

1. **生成公钥**:在创建钱包时,首先会生成一对密钥(公钥和私钥)。此时,用户拥有了公钥。 2. **生成地址**:以太坊地址是通过对公钥进行哈希运算以及格式化后获取的。具体过程是:

- 公钥的Keccak-256哈希 - 最后取哈希的后40个十六进制字符,并加上“0x”前缀

由此可见,以太坊地址是公钥的衍生,而公钥本身是生成地址的原始材料。因此,公钥与地址之间存在着重要的联系,但其用途是不同的:公钥可以用于加密和签名,而地址则主要用于收款。

#### 使用公钥进行交易的流程是什么样的?

使用公钥进行交易的流程是什么样的?

解密以太坊钱包公钥:安全与隐私的保障之路

进行以太坊交易的流程可以分为以下几个步骤:

1. **创建交易**:用户需要在他们的钱包应用程序中输入接收方的以太坊地址(公钥),以及要发送的ETH数量。交易信息还包括交易费用,这会影响交易的确认时间。 2. **签名交易**:交易创建后,钱包会使用用户的私钥对交易进行数字签名。这一步骤确保了交易的有效性以及发送方的身份验证,任何人都无法伪造交易。 3. **广播交易**:完成签名的交易会被广播到以太坊网络,待网络节点确认。节点会根据交易信息,并结合区块链上已有的数据,验证交易的合法性。 4. **矿工打包交易**:成功验证后,这笔交易将被矿工打包到区块中,并添加到区块链上。交易确认后,接收方就能够在其钱包中看到已收到的资产。

为了确保交易的成功,用户需要有足够的手续费(Gas),以便处理交易的计算和存储需求。手续费的高低会影响交易被打包的速度。

#### 如何保护以太坊钱包的隐私?

如何保护以太坊钱包的隐私?

在以太坊网络中,所有交易都是公开透明的。这意味着任何人都可以查看到同一钱包地址进行的交易历史。因此,用户保护隐私的措施显得尤为重要:

1. **使用新地址接收资金**:为了提高隐私性,用户可以为每个新交易使用不同的钱包地址,这样能有效阻止第三方通过分析交易历史追踪到用户的资产动向。 2. **使用混币服务**:混币服务可以将多个用户的交易混合在一起,使得用户难以追踪资金的具体来源和去向。虽然未必完全安全,但能提高隐私性。 3. **选择隐私币**:对于对隐私有更高需求的用户,可以选择使用一些专门为隐私保护设计的加密货币,如Monero或Zcash。这些币种的交易设计为更难以追踪。 4. **提升网络安全**:使用安全的软件和硬件、定期更改密码、在不熟悉的网络中避免进行交易都能提高网络安全,防止个人信息被盗取。

保护隐私是用户在参与以太坊及其他区块链活动过程中需重视的内容,确保资金和信息安全是每位参与者的责任。

#### 以太坊钱包的类型和选择建议

以太坊钱包的类型和选择建议

解密以太坊钱包公钥:安全与隐私的保障之路

以太坊钱包种类繁多,用户在选择时较需考量不同类型钱包的安全性和使用便利性,一般布并分为以下几类:

1. **软件钱包**:包括桌面钱包和移动钱包。这类钱包使用方便,适合日常使用和小额交易,如MetaMask、Trust Wallet等。尽管软件钱包安全性较高,但由于是连接网络的,仍需谨慎使用,并确保使用正规应用。 2. **硬件钱包**:如Ledger和Trezor等,硬件钱包通常被认为是最安全的存储方式。它们可以离线存储用户资产,大大降低被黑客攻击的风险。虽然相对价格较高,但适合储存大额资产的用户使用。 3. **纸钱包**:将公钥和私钥打印在纸上来离线存储。这一方式最大程度避免了黑客攻击,但用户需妥善保存,避免纸张损坏或丢失。 4. **中心化交易所钱包**:如Binance和Coinbase等平台提供的在线钱包。其便捷性高,但因用户需将资产存放在平台上,风险相对较大,建议仅用于短期交易。

选择合适的钱包类型应依据用户的需求,例如资产的多少、交易频繁程度、安全偏好等。对于大部分用户,结合使用软件钱包和硬件钱包可达到方便与安全的平衡。

### 总结

以太坊钱包公钥在数字资产的使用中扮演着至关重要的角色。只有深入理解公钥的结构、功能和管理技巧,用户才能在以太坊网络中更好地保护自己的资产。希望通过本篇文章的讨论,您能更好地掌握以太坊钱包公钥的相关知识,提高自己的安全意识,持续保持对技术和市场的关注,抓住区块链发展的机遇。

### 结束语

以太坊及其钱包在未来的区块链生态中仍将发挥重要作用。我们鼓励用户保持谨慎和学习的态度,不断提升自己的知识水平,以便在这个快速变化的数字经济时代中占得先机。